The Progression System: A Key to Unlocking Multiplayer
Gran Turismo 7 employs a progression system that requires players to complete certain tasks and milestones before they can access multiplayer features. This system is designed to ensure that players have a solid understanding of the game’s mechanics and have developed their skills before entering the competitive arena.
-
Completing the Driving School: One of the first steps in unlocking multiplayer is completing the Driving School. This section of the game teaches players the basics of racing, including braking, cornering, and overtaking. By completing these lessons, players not only improve their skills but also unlock access to more advanced features, including multiplayer.
-
Earning Licenses: Gran Turismo 7 features a licensing system that tests players’ abilities in various driving scenarios. Earning higher-level licenses is often a prerequisite for accessing certain multiplayer modes. For example, players may need to obtain a B-level license before they can participate in online races.
-
Building Your Garage: Another aspect of the progression system is building your garage. Players need to acquire and upgrade a variety of cars to compete effectively in multiplayer races. This process involves earning credits through races, completing challenges, and purchasing cars from the in-game dealership.

Exploring Different Multiplayer Modes
Once multiplayer is unlocked, players can explore a variety of modes that cater to different playstyles and preferences. These modes include:
-
Casual Lobbies: These are open lobbies where players can join and race against others in a more relaxed environment. Casual lobbies are ideal for players who want to practice their skills or enjoy a less competitive racing experience.
-
Ranked Races: For those seeking a more competitive experience, ranked races offer a structured environment where players can compete for higher rankings and rewards. These races often require players to meet certain criteria, such as having a specific license level or car.
-
Custom Events: Gran Turismo 7 also allows players to create custom events, where they can set the rules, tracks, and car restrictions. This mode is perfect for players who want to organize races with friends or create unique challenges.
